chromium/tools/perf/page_sets/tough_canvas_cases/rendering_throughput/stroke_shapes.html

<!DOCTYPE html>
<html>
<head></head>

<body>
<canvas id="canvas" width="800" height="600">
<script type="text/javascript" src="bench.js"></script>
<script type="text/javascript" src="canvas_tough_cases_lib.js"></script>
<script type="text/javascript" src="stroke_shapes.js"></script>

<script type="text/javascript">
window.onload = init;

var canvas;
var context;

function init() {
  canvas = document.getElementById('canvas');
  context = canvas.getContext('2d');

  num_shapes = 1000;
  stage_stroke_shapes.init(num_shapes, 800, 600);
  stage_stroke_shapes.draw(context);

  bench.run(draw);
}

function draw() {
  context.clearRect(0, 0, 800, 600);
  stage_stroke_shapes.draw(context);
};

</script>

</body>

</html>